Please do not edit these lines, except to modify the commit id +! if you have ported upstream changes. +-/ +import Mathlib.Topology.Sheaves.Forget +import Mathlib.CategoryTheory.Limits.Shapes.Types +import Mathlib.Topology.Sheaves.Sheaf +import Mathlib.CategoryTheory.Types + +/-! +# The sheaf condition in terms of unique gluings + +We provide an alternative formulation of the sheaf condition in terms of unique gluings. + +We work with sheaves valued in a concrete category `C` admitting all limits, whose forgetful +functor `C ⥤ Type` preserves limits and reflects isomorphisms. The usual categories of algebraic +structures, such as `Mon`, `AddCommGroup`, `Ring`, `CommRing` etc. are all examples of this kind of +category. + +A presheaf `F : presheaf C X` satisfies the sheaf condition if and only if, for every +compatible family of sections `sf : Π i : ι, F.obj (op (U i))`, there exists a unique gluing +`s : F.obj (op (supr U))`. + +Here, the family `sf` is called compatible, if for all `i j : ι`, the restrictions of `sf i` +and `sf j` to `U i ⊓ U j` agree. A section `s : F.obj (op (supr U))` is a gluing for the +family `sf`, if `s` restricts to `sf i` on `U i` for all `i : ι` + +We show that the sheaf condition in terms of unique gluings is equivalent to the definition +in terms of equalizers. Our approach is as follows: First, we show them to be equivalent for +`Type`-valued presheaves. Then we use that composing a presheaf with a limit-preserving and +isomorphism-reflecting functor leaves the sheaf condition invariant, as shown in +`topology/sheaves/forget.lean`. + +-/ + + +noncomputable section + +open TopCat + +open TopCat.Presheaf + +open TopCat.Presheaf.SheafConditionEqualizerProducts + +open CategoryTheory + +open CategoryTheory.Limits + +open TopologicalSpace + +open TopologicalSpace.Opens + +open Opposite + +universe u v + +variable {C : Type u} [Category.{v} C] [ConcreteCategory.{v} C] + +namespace TopCat + +namespace Presheaf + +section + +attribute [local instance] ConcreteCategory.hasCoeToSort ConcreteCategory.hasCoeToFun + +variable {X : TopCat.{v}} (F : Presheaf C X) {ι : Type v} (U : ι → Opens X) + +/-- A family of sections `sf` is compatible, if the restrictions of `sf i` and `sf j` to `U i ⊓ U j` +agree, for all `i` and `j` +-/ +def IsCompatible (sf : ∀ i : ι, F.obj (op (U i))) : Prop := + ∀ i j : ι, F.map (infLELeft (U i) (U j)).op (sf i) = F.map (infLERight (U i) (U j)).op (sf j) +set_option linter.uppercaseLean3 false in +#align Top.presheaf.is_compatible TopCat.Presheaf.IsCompatible + +/-- A section `s` is a gluing for a family of sections `sf` if it restricts to `sf i` on `U i`, +for all `i` +-/ +def IsGluing (sf : ∀ i : ι, F.obj (op (U i))) (s : F.obj (op (iSup U))) : Prop := + ∀ i : ι, F.map (Opens.leSupr U i).op s = sf i +set_option linter.uppercaseLean3 false in +#align Top.presheaf.is_gluing TopCat.Presheaf.IsGluing + +/-- +The sheaf condition in terms of unique gluings.
